Leads to of Blood Parasite Illness
The commonest blood parasites influencing chickens are Plasmodium, Leucocytozoon, and Haemoproteus. These organisms are transmitted by insect bites. At the time within a chicken’s bloodstream, they invade red blood cells and various interior organs, resulting in anemia, weakened immunity, and in severe instances, death.

Plasmodium is answerable for avian malaria which is transmitted by mosquitoes.

Leucocytozoon will cause leucocytozoonosis which is spread by blackflies.

Haemoproteus is taken into account significantly less intense but can nonetheless induce overall health problems, Primarily in combination with other stressors.

Just about every of these parasites can severely influence the overall health and fitness of chickens, especially in regions where vector insects are abundant and Handle actions are lacking.

Indicators and Wellbeing Outcomes
Blood parasite infections frequently present moderate or imprecise signs or symptoms at first, which is why the disease frequently goes unnoticed till it gets to be intense. Frequent signs involve:

Pale or discolored combs and wattles (a sign of anemia)

Lethargy and weak spot

Diminished appetite and weightloss

Diminished egg manufacturing

Environmentally friendly or watery droppings

Issues respiratory in more Highly developed stages

Chickens underneath worry or with weakened immune techniques are more likely to demonstrate acute indications. In younger birds, blood parasite bacterial infections can lead to sudden death.

Cure Issues
Treating blood parasite bacterial infections in poultry might be hard. While some antiprotozoal medicines like chloroquine or quinine could be successful, their use in foods-generating animals is usually controlled resulting from problems about drug residues in meat and eggs. Also, treatment method just isn't usually curative, and reinfection can manifest if vector Regulate is just not maintained.

Supportive treatment such as increasing nutrition, hydration, and minimizing strain can help infected birds Get well. However, the most effective tactic continues to be avoidance.

Avoidance and Manage
Avoiding blood parasite sickness entails controlling the vectors that spread the infection. Key steps include things like:

Removing standing h2o and controlling waste to limit insect breeding

Installing good mesh screens or making use of insect netting in poultry houses

Applying safe insect repellents or environmental remedies

Working towards superior biosecurity, particularly when introducing new birds on the flock

Monitoring birds consistently for early signs of sickness
